The first Particle, Astroparticle and Cosmology Tallinn Symposium, PACTS 2018, hosted by the Laboratory of High Energy and Computational Physics at the NICPB, will be held at the Ungern-Sternberg palace in Tallinn, Estonia, on June 18-22, 2018.

The conference aims at promoting productive discussions about recent developments in theoretical and experimental high energy physics,  cosmology and gravity with the general purpose of identifying the framework of new physics beyond the current paradigms. Our intention is to bring together experts from different fields to help sharing their knowledge outside their specialized communities.
 
The program consists of plenary sessions with presentations covering, but not being limited to, the  following topics:
 
Defining naturalness: which guiding principle?
Results from the LHC phases I and II
Properties of the dark sector of the Universe
Potential of the intensity frontier
New physics in flavor
Status of the LCDM model and its extensions
Gravitational wave astronomy, phase transitions, black holes
Inflation and theories of gravity
